Why Emotional Resilience is Crucial for Real Estate Success

Abstract art of woman in deep thought, emotional resilience theme.

Understanding the Emotional Impact of Real Estate

Entering the real estate industry can feel like a daunting rollercoaster. The highs are exhilarating, yet the lows can plummet you into a state of overwhelming stress. According to a study by the National Association of Realtors, approximately 62% of agents report experiencing significant stress due to market fluctuations and client demands. This alarming statistic reflects a broader truth—that emotional resilience is crucial in this high-pressure field.

Building Emotional Resilience in Real Estate

Fortunately, emotional resilience can be cultivated through specific, actionable steps. Research published by Harvard Business Review emphasizes that professionals with high emotional resilience not only survive the tumult but thrive in it. This adaptability results in better decision-making and sustained performance over time. Here’s how agents can craft their emotional toolkit:

The Five Pillars of Resilience

1. Self-Awareness: Know Your Triggers

Understanding what stresses you is the first step to managing it effectively. Engage in practices like journaling, which not only helps you track daily patterns in your mood but also gives you insights into what triggers negative feelings. A few minutes daily can empower you to take control of your mindset.

2. Proactive Stress Management

Learning how to manage stress before it becomes overwhelming is vital in real estate. Techniques such as box breathing can be remarkably effective in calming your nervous system during moments of high tension. Pair this with regular physical activity to combat the sedentary nature of office work, giving your mind and body the break they deserve.

3. Reframing Challenges

Challenges and setbacks are integral parts of any agent's journey. A shift in perspective can make all the difference in how these setbacks are perceived. Instead of viewing a lost deal as a failure, try to see it as a valuable learning opportunity. Implement a gratitude practice focusing on one positive aspect of each experience.

4. Routine for Stability

Structured daily routines can provide a sense of stability amid chaos. Whether it’s making your bed in the morning or following a specific coffee ritual, those small accomplishments can set a positive tone for the day.

5. Developing a Support Network

Building a community of support can prove invaluable. Surround yourself with peers and mentors who understand the rollercoaster of real estate. Their insights can provide not only practical advice but also emotional strength during challenging times.

Discover Why Indianapolis is the Most Buyer-Friendly Market in 2026

Update Indianapolis: A Bright Beacon for Homebuyers In a recent report by Zillow, Indianapolis has earned the title of the most buyer-friendly real estate market for 2026, making it a prime target for aspiring homeowners. This reputation comes as homebuyers increasingly seek areas with a favorable pricing landscape and manageable monthly mortgage costs. With a typical home value around $283,040, Indianapolis presents a market that balances affordability with modest growth, promising a less stressful homebuying experience. Understanding the Affordability Landscape What sets Indianapolis apart is its appealing affordability for median earners. According to Zillow Senior Economist Dr. Orphe Divounguy, buyers can expect to allocate only 26.9 percent of their monthly income to mortgage payments, comfortably below the generally accepted 30 percent threshold. This statistic positions Indianapolis amongst other affordable markets such as Oklahoma City, Memphis, and Detroit—all boasting similar monthly income shares for mortgage payments. The Bigger Picture in Buyer-Friendly Markets Indianapolis isn't alone in the limelight. Zillow's findings reveal that other cities in the South, Midwest, and Mid-Atlantic regions also provide attractive opportunities for homebuyers. Cities like Atlanta, Charlotte, and Tampa, while experiencing flat or even slight declines in home interest, are also recognized as markets where buyers can negotiate more easily as the winter months slow activity. For instance, areas such as Pittsburgh and Memphis stand out for their lower home values, which can be incredibly enticing for first-time buyers or those looking to downsize. Steady Growth and Future Prospects While Indianapolis displays a calm market affected by a 0.2 percent monthly increase and a 2.9 percent annual increase in home values, this steady growth opens an avenue for potential buyers who have been eyeing a favorable entry point. Dr. Divounguy emphasizes the importance of strategic pricing for sellers in such an environment. As competition remains lower, buyers benefit from not feeling rushed, fostering an atmosphere for thoughtful decision-making. Buying Amidst Challenges Yet, amid this encouraging news, potential homebuyers should remain aware of the broader national trends. For some cities, particularly hotter markets like Miami, the stark contrast is visible as median earners face mortgage payments eating up an alarming 46.7 percent of their income, showcasing the disparities evident in current real estate landscapes.
